PM Modi to hold meeting with State Chief Ministers on May 11

Prime Minister Narendra Modi will hold the 5th meeting with State Chief Ministers via video-conference, on Monday, May 11, 2020  at 3 PM to discuss the situation due to Covid-19.

In a tweet, the Prime Minister’s Office  said,  “PM Modi to hold the 5th meeting via video-conference with state Chief Ministers tomorrow afternoon at 3 PM”.

India has so far witnessed 62,939 Covid-19 cases with 2,109 deaths. There are 41,472 active cases while 19,357 have been cured/discharged.

Maharashtra has highest COVID-19 cases – 20,228, followed by Gujarat – 7,796, Delhi – 6,542, Tamil Nadu – 6,535, Rajasthan – 3,708 and Madhya Pradesh – 3,614.
